**Q: Who can trigger the Nocturne backfill scheduler?**

Only members of the data-ops group. Runs are nightly at 02:10, scoped per dataset, with credentials pulled from the Vaultridge broker at execution time. No secrets are stored in job configs. All runs are logged immutably. The permission model and audit procedure are described on the internal page below.

wiki page, bagaf-fawip: https://harbor.tolvaqsys.local/pages/repo/pages/secrets/eac969ffc71f356b

Leadership Review Briefing — Churn in the Fernhale Pilot

Sales leads: churn in the Fernhale pilot programme reached 11% this quarter, above the 7% target. Exit interviews point to onboarding gaps and pricing confusion rather than product faults. A simplified tier structure and guided setup flow are being tested with a control group through next month. Full results will be tabled at the next leadership review. The confidential note below describes the planned commercial response.

internal memo for kawip-hadug: Headcount on the Wenwyn team goes from 7 to 140 by the end of January. Gross margin on Wenwyn came in at 20 percent against a plan of 15 percent.

## Who to contact — Graphwright dependency visualizer

Graphwright renders module dependency graphs consumed during code review at Fennelworks. Ownership is split: the rendering engine belongs to the Lattice team, while graph extraction rules belong to Build Tooling. Reviewers who spot incorrect edges, missing transitive nodes, or stale caches should first note the commit hash shown in the graph footer. Send rendering and extraction issues alike to the address below.

escalation mailbox, bafog-fafog: ulador@paliqlabs.internal